Just rang them up and said I had the text and wanted to cancel, they asked no questions and said they will send out a SIM with my new number as PAYG within 30 days and I will be billed up until I get the new PAYG SIM. My contract wasnt up until April so am quite pleased with that as I wanted to leave anyway.
They didnt haggle they just did it, I took the name and phone number of the operative so I can retrace.
Maybe they are just grateful I am staying with Orange PAYG for now and havent lost a customer altogether, I will probably stay with them as long as they offer a decent deal now on PAYG because of how I was treated, if they had been ar*ey I would have gone somewhere else so all credit to them I say0 -

weezerfly30 wrote: »arghhhhhhhhh..just called them and ended up at billing, he was saying the changes are for the better...whats the 5p thing everyone is mentioning as 've just been told i was paying 20p if i went over to over mobiles,
The 20p that you are paying at the moment is the per minute charge but it's not the per minute charges for calls that are changing, it is the minimum call charges.
eg/ At the moment if you call an 08 number for only 1 second the minimum charge would be 5p
As of September the 1 second call will cost you 14.7p.0 -
